TCK-4471: Offline vault locked — Fernline survey app

For weekly sync. Field crews can't sync Fernline's offline survey bundles; the local credential vault locked after the v3.2 update reset device clocks. Offline mode still captures data, but uploads queue indefinitely. Workaround exists: unlock the vault manually on each tablet before Thursday's deployment to the Harrowfen site. Steps: open settings, tap the vault icon five times, choose manual recovery, and enter the recovery passphrase provided directly below this note.

strongbox words: oliath-framir

Finance Review Summary — Retail Pilot

Branch managers: the twelve-week pilot with the Fernleigh Stores chain closed last month. Sell-through exceeded plan by 9%, though fit-out costs ran over budget in the Oakmere and Dalton branches. Margin per unit landed at target once promotional support ended. Fernleigh has signalled interest in a broader rollout covering up to forty locations. Finance has modelled three expansion scenarios with differing capital requirements. The recommended path forward is summarised in the confidential note below.

internal memo for tagug-fawig: Only 3 of the 100 pilot accounts renewed Zorael, so a churn review is set for April 1.

# Brackenford SFTP Drop — Environment Variables

The nightly exporter pushes reconciliation files to the Brackenford partner SFTP drop at 02:15 local. If transfers fail, check `DROP_HOST` and `DROP_PORT` first; those change when the partner rotates infrastructure. `DROP_RETRY_MAX` defaults to 5 and rarely needs touching. The exporter authenticates with a passphrase-style credential set in the service's .env file, on the following line:

sealed setting: LEDGER_TOKEN13=5d842615a26d7

# Fabrikit test-data factory config.
# Seeds deterministic fixtures for the staging suite. Do not point at prod.
# FABRIKIT_SEED controls reproducibility; change only when fixtures drift.
# FABRIKIT_POOL sets worker count — keep at 4 on the shared runner.
# If factories hang, check the seed service first, then restart the runner.
# The factory service token goes on the next line.

sealed setting: RELAY_SECRET5=82864